Smothered Summer Squash With Basil
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 12 lbs summer squash (halved lengthwise & cut crosswise into 1/8-inch slices)
- 2 garlic cloves (finely chopped)
- 12 cup water
- 14 teaspoon salt
- 18 teaspoon black pepper
- 14 cup fresh basil (finely chopped)
- Heat 1 T oil in a heavy skillet over high heat until hot but not smoking; add half of squash & saute', stirring occasionally until browned, about 5 minute Transfer browned squash to a bowl, then repeat to cook other 1/2 of squash.
- Return squash to skillet; add garlic & saute', stirring occasionally for 1 minute Add water, salt & pepper; simmer briskly, covered, until squash is tender & most of liquid is evaporated, 6-7 minute Stir in basil.
